How do communication towers receive signals

Communication towers receive signals from mobile devices using antennas that capture radio waves, convert them into electrical signals via transceivers, and relay the data through backhaul connections to the network.Signal Reception ProcessCommunication towers, also known as cell towers or base transceiver stations, are equipped with antennas that capture radio frequency (RF) signals emitted by mobile devices. These signals are electromagnetic waves carrying voice, text, or data information . The antennas are often mounted high on the tower to maximize line-of-sight coverage and reduce interference from obstacles like buildings or terrain . Once the RF signal is received, it is sent through transceivers, which convert the radio waves into electrical signals that can be processed by the network . The transceiver also performs the reverse function, converting electrical signals from the network into RF waves for transmission back to mobile devices.Network IntegrationAfter conversion, the signal travels via backhaul connections to the mobile switching center (MSC) or core network. Backhaul can be implemented using fiber optic cables in urban areas for high-speed data transfer or microwave links in remote locations . The MSC routes the call or data to its intended destination, whether another mobile device or an internet server, ensuring seamless connectivity.Advanced TechnologiesModern towers often use MIMO (Multiple Input Multiple Output) antennas to transmit and receive multiple data streams simultaneously, increasing capacity and efficiency . Beamforming technology directs RF signals toward specific devices, improving signal strength and reducing interference in high-traffic areas. These technologies allow towers to handle thousands of simultaneous connections while maintaining low latency and high data throughput.SummaryIn essence, communication towers function as intermediaries between mobile devices and the network. They capture RF signals via antennas, convert them into digital data through transceivers, and transmit the data through backhaul connections to the network infrastructure, enabling reliable voice, text, and internet services across wide geographic areas .
